Robert Kelly is a CFA® charterholder with 17 years of industry experience, currently serving as a financial advisor at Farther since 2021. His prior experience includes roles at Bank of America, Merrill, JPMorgan Chase Bank, and Grisanti Capital Management. He is a trustee for Imagine, A Center for Coping with Loss, a nonprofit providing free grief services to children. Farther serves individual investors, trusts, and estates through a technology-driven advisory platform and discretionary investment management. The firm’s approach is based on Modern Portfolio Theory, using bespoke and algorithmic model portfolios primarily invested in ETFs, mutual funds, equities, and fixed income.
